Wild Rider was a compact steel roller coaster featuring a lattice structure and a series of sharp turns and sudden drops. The ride used individual cars that navigated a convoluted track layout characterized by tight radii and quick transitions. Riders experienced several helices and airtime hills before returning to the station platform.
